Bridge Fire, one of the three wildfires ravaging California, has exploded to “48,000 acres in 48 hours”.
The other wildfires are Line Fire and Airport Fire.
According to France 24: “#California on Wednesday declared a state of emergency over three #wildfires near Los Angeles, including one that has engulfed dozens of homes across two towns.
“The San Bernardino County #blaze, named the #BridgeFire, exploded to 48,000 acres in 48 hours, becoming the largest in the state.
By Wednesday the three fires had blackened over 105,000 acres of scrub, brush and forest, an area a third the size of #LosAngeles.”
